Questões

Pratique com questões de diversas disciplinas e universidades

1.116 questões encontradas(exibindo 10)

Página 29 de 112
A estrutura 'enquanto ... faça', correspondente, está indicada na seguinte alternativa:
A
atribuir 13 a I; atribuir 0 a X; atribuir 0 a Y; enquanto I > 0 faça atribuir I-1 a I; dividir I por 2 e atribuir o resto a X; somar X com Y e atribuir a soma a Y; fim-enquanto; Imprimir (I,X,Y);
B
atribuir 13 a I; atribuir 0 a X; atribuir 0 a Y; enquanto I > 1 faça atribuir I-I a I; dividir I por 2 e atribuir o resto a X; somar X com Y e atribuir a soma a Y; fim-enquanto; Imprimir (I,X,Y);
C
atribuir 14 a I; atribuir 0 a X; atribuir 0 a Y; enquanto I > 1 faça atribuir I-1 a I; dividir I por 2 e atribuir o resto a X; somar X com Y e atribuir a soma a Y; fim-enquanto; Imprimir (I,X,Y);
D
atribuir 14 a I; atribuir 0 a X; atribuir 0 a Y; enquanto I > 0 faça atribuir I-1 a I; dividir I por 2 e atribuir o resto a X; somar X com Y e atribuir a soma a Y; fim-enquanto; Imprimir (I,X,Y);

Qual a diferença entre o código fonte e o código objeto?

A

Não existem diferenças práticas, apenas dois nomes diferentes para a mesma ação.

B

O código fonte é uma coleção de instruções de computador escritas usando um manual legível por humanos a partir de uma linguagem de programação, enquanto o código objeto representa uma sequência de instruções em uma linguagem de máquina e é a saída após o compilador converter o código fonte.

C

O código objeto é uma coleção de instruções de computador falada, usando um manual legível por humanos a partir de uma linguagem robótica, enquanto o código de fonte representa uma sequência de instruções do Word e é a saída após o compilador converter o código fonte.

D

O código fonte é uma instrução única de computador usando um manual ilegível por humanos a partir de uma linguagem de programação de máquinas, enquanto o código objeto representa uma sequência de instruções em uma linguagem de representações de figuras criptografadas.

E

A única diferença entre eles é por parte dos fornecedores que optam usar nomenclaturas diferentes para se destacar contra os concorrentes.

Qual das seguintes tecnologias é considerada uma das principais impulsionadoras da Quarta Revolução Industrial, caracterizada pela fusão de tecnologias que borram as linhas entre as esferas física, digital e biológica?

A
Impressão 3D
B
Energia solar
C
Smartphone
D
Internet das Coisas (IoT)
Dadas as proposições simples 'p', 'q' e 'r' onde V(p)=F, V(q)=F e V(r)=V, os valores lógicos das proposições compostas '\sim p + r' e 'q + \sim r' são, respectivamente.
A
V e V
B
V e F
C
F e V
D
F e F

Assinale a opção correta para característica da criptografia simétrica.

A

O tempo para criptografar uma mensagem é extremamente alto, podendo levar dias para ser decifrado.

B

Ambas as chaves de criptografia são públicas, contudo apenas tendo a mensagem é possível descobrir qual chave deve ser utilizada.

C

Os algoritmos de criptografia simétrica são altamente complexos e seguros.

D

É considerado o modelo mais antigo de criptografia, sendo simples e veloz para execução de procedimentos criptográficos.

E

É uma criptografia que utiliza chaves distintas que não precisam ser compartilhadas entre as partes.

Qual é o objetivo do código apresentado?

A

Realizar a leitura de notas de alunos.

B

Realizar operações matemáticas com matrizes.

C

Apresentar exemplos de utilização de laços de repetição.

D

Apresentar exemplos de utilização de matrizes.

E

Nenhuma das alternativas anteriores.

A programação orientada a objetos (ou POO) é a programação dominante nos paradigmas atuais, tendo substituído a programação “estruturada”, que é baseada em técnicas de programação que foram desenvolvidas no início dos anos 70. A chave para ser mais produtivo na POO é:

A
Projetar um conjunto de funções (ou algoritmos) para resolver um problema.
B
Analisar os algoritmos que operam os dados.
C
Tornar inúmeros objetos responsáveis por executar um conjunto de tarefas aleatórias.
D
Colocar um objeto para manipular diretamente os dados internos de outro objeto.
E
Tornar cada objeto responsável por executar um conjunto de tarefas relacionadas.

Indique qual é o tipo de dados que possui apenas dois valores possíveis: True ou False.

A
Tipo inteiro ou int.
B
Tipo cadeia de caracteres ou string ou str
C
Tipo lista ou list.
D
Tipo lógico ou bool.
E
Tipo float para números reais
Com base na definição de algoritmos, assinale a opção que apresenta um algoritmo válido.
A
Abrir o aplicativo → escrever a mensagem → selecionar o remetente → escrever o título → anexar o arquivo → enviar.
B
Abrir o aplicativo → escrever a mensagem.
C
Selecionar o remetente → escrever o título.
D
Anexar o arquivo → enviar.

Com relação às estruturas de repetição (ou laços) na linguagem C, o for, while e do-while. Qual opção abaixo é verdadeira?

A

O laço do .. while executa sempre, pelo menos uma vez, o corpo do laço.

B

Os laços while e for executam sempre, pelo menos uma vez, o corpo do laço.

C

A condição dentro de um laço while e do-while não precisa ser colocada dentro de parênteses.

D

No laço for ou while, o número de vezes que a condição é testada é sempre igual ao número de iterações do laço.

E

No laço for, o número de vezes que as cargas iniciais são executadas (inicialização) é sempre igual ao número de iterações do laço.